| Date (from) | (Date to) | Personal |
| 10 January 1848 | | Married Julia, fourth daughter of John Harrison, of Cavendish Square, London |
| 30 July 1887 | | Died (Ashford, Kent) |
| |
| Date | Rank |
| 5 March 1818 | Entered Navy |
| 6 May 1829 | Lieutenant |
| 1 August 1840 | Commander |
| 9 November 1846 | Captain |
| 28 October 1864 | Rear-Admiral |
| 1 April 1870 | Retired Rear-Admiral |
| 14 July 1871 | Retired Vice-Admiral |
| 1 August 1877 | Retired Admiral |
| |
| Date from | Date to | Service |
| 1 July 1837 | | Lieutenant and commander in Comet, particular service |
| 11 April 1843 | February 1847 | Commander in Cormorant (from commissioning), Pacific coast of South America |
| (10 January 1848) | | Captain in Ganges |
| 7 September 1849 | 15 September 1852 | Captain in Encounter (from commissioning at Portsmouth until paying off at Portsmouth), particular service |
| 6 March 1854 | 31 January 1855 | Captain in Windsor Castle, flagship of Vice-Admiral Charles Napier, the Baltic during the Russian War |
| 1 February 1855 | 1 March 1856 | Captain in Victory, flagship of Rear-Admiral Thomas John Cochrane, Portsmouth |
| 29 June 1858 | 24 April 1859 | Captain in Hannibal, guard ship of Ordinary, Portsmouth (replaced by Asia) |
| 25 April 1859 | 18 May 1861 | Captain in Asia, guard ship of Ordinary, Portsmouth (replacing Hannibal) |
